Cannabis Use and Dementia Risk: Evaluating Neurological and Cardiovascular Implications

cannabis dementia cardiovascular risks
04/30/2025

Emerging data from one of the most comprehensive cohort studies to date is reshaping the conversation around cannabis and public health. Long viewed through the lens of pain management, recreation, and mental health, cannabis is now under scrutiny for a very different set of outcomes: its ties to dementia and serious cardiovascular events. The findings are not only raising eyebrows—they’re triggering urgent calls for clinicians to treat cannabis use disorder as a pressing clinical risk factor.

Involving data from over six million individuals, the study—recently published in JAMA Neurology—sheds light on a concerning trend. Individuals who had cannabis-related hospital encounters were found to have a 23% increased risk of developing dementia within five years. Even more starkly, when compared to the general population, these patients were at a 72% elevated risk. These are not marginal numbers. They suggest a cognitive trajectory that deviates sharply from typical age-related decline, and one potentially accelerated by cannabis exposure.

This doesn’t suggest cannabis use alone guarantees dementia, but the correlation in hospitalized individuals underscores a critical intersection: the role of substance use in chronic disease pathways. Importantly, these findings challenge the assumption—popularized in some public narratives—that cannabis is largely benign when compared to other substances.

Neurologists aren’t the only ones taking note. The cardiovascular implications are proving just as urgent. Additional data point to a marked rise in adverse cardiac events among cannabis users, including myocardial infarctions, strokes, and arrhythmias. A growing body of research, including work published by the American Heart Association, indicates a 25–34% increased risk of heart attacks, particularly among users of high-potency marijuana. This risk escalates further for individuals with pre-existing heart conditions, positioning cannabis as a potential trigger in vulnerable populations.

While causality cannot yet be definitively established, the convergence of cognitive and cardiovascular complications in cannabis-using populations has been consistent across multiple data sets. Such evidence calls for heightened clinical vigilance. Specialists in both neurology and cardiology are now being urged to incorporate cannabis use screening into their standard evaluations, particularly for patients presenting with early cognitive symptoms or unexplained cardiac episodes.

The conversation around cannabis use disorder is also evolving. With potency levels of commercial cannabis at all-time highs—and usage rates climbing across age groups—what was once a fringe diagnosis is becoming a central concern. Screening for cannabis use disorder (CUD) in routine primary care visits could serve as a vital touchpoint for prevention, especially as research from institutions like the University of Bath highlights its association with addiction and psychiatric comorbidities.

This is more than a question of individual risk. From a systems perspective, unaddressed cannabis-related complications could pose a substantial burden on already stretched neurology and cardiology services. Public health policymakers, too, are beginning to recognize the ripple effects. Failure to intervene early could translate to long-term increases in dementia care demands and cardiac event-related hospitalizations.

To that end, the evidence supports more than just screening—it argues for targeted education and tailored intervention. Clinicians may benefit from updated protocols that address not only cannabis cessation, but also the monitoring of cognitive function and cardiovascular metrics over time. Meanwhile, patient education campaigns might serve to recalibrate public understanding, particularly among populations who perceive cannabis as risk-free due to its legal status.

As cannabis becomes more culturally and legally entrenched, the healthcare community faces a delicate challenge: acknowledging its therapeutic potential while rigorously addressing its emerging harms. This latest research marks a pivotal moment—one in which early clinical action could make the difference between managing risk and reacting to crisis.
